AN EASYJET flight from Cyprus was forced to divert to Amsterdam when a passenger went on a drunken rampage through the plane.
The British man, in his 50s, became increasingly abusive after the plane took off from Paphos on Wednesday evening, and eventually had to be restrained by a man thought to be an off-duty police officer.

A LOTTO winner who scooped £11million but lived like a hermit in Scotland has died at the age of 73. Paul Maddison and his former business partner Mark Gardiner won over £22million in the lottery jackpot in 1995. A WOMAN has claimed her Facebook was hacked after clicking on a used car advert and the alleged scammers are said to be using it to defraud drivers.
Ellie White Turner, 20, says she has been locked out of her account and the US social media giant has done nothing to help get her profile back.
